LITE-ON TECHNOLOGY CORPORATION Property of LITE-ON Only ABSOLUTE MAXIMUM RATING ( Ta = 25°C ) PARAMETER SYMBOL RATING UNIT Forward Current I F ±50 mA INPUT Power Dissipation P 70 mW Collector - Emitter Voltage V CEO 35 V Emitter - Collector Voltage V ECO 6 V Collector - Base Voltage V CBO 35 V Emitter - Base Voltage V EBO 6 V Collector Current I C 50 mA OUTPUT Collector Power Dissipation P C 150 mW Total Power Dissipation P tot 200 mW *1 Isolation Voltage V iso 5,000 Vrms Operating Temperature T opr -30 ~ +100 °C Storage Temperature T stg -55 ~ +125 °C *2 Soldering Temperature T sol 260 °C *1. AC For 1 Minute, R.H. = 40 ~ 60% Isolation voltage shall be measured using the following method. (1) Short between anode and cathode on the primary side and between collector and emitter on the secondary side. (2) The isolation voltage tester with zero-cross circuit shall be used. (3) The waveform of applied voltage shall be a sine wave. *2. For 10 Seconds Part No. : LTV-733 ( M, S, -TA1 ) Page : 5o f9 BNS-OD-C131/A4

LITE-ON TECHNOLOGY CORPORATION Property of LITE-ON Only ELECTRICAL - OPTICAL CHARACTERISTICS ( Ta = 25°C ) PARAMETER SYMBOL MIN. TYP. MAX. UNIT CONDITIONS Forward Voltage V F — 1.2 1.4 V IF=±20mA INPUT Terminal Capacitance C t — 50 250 pF V=0, f=1KHz Collector Dark Current I CEO — — 100 nA V CE=20V, IF=0 Collector-Emitter Breakdown Voltage BVCEO 35 — — V IC=0.1mA IF=0 OUTPUT Emitter-Collector Breakdown Voltage BVECO 6 — — V IE=10µA IF=0 Collector Current I C 0.2 — 3 mA * Current Transfer Ratio CTR 20 — 300 % IF=±1mA VCE=5V Collector-Emitter Saturation Voltage VCE(sat) — 0.1 0.2 V IF=±20mA IC=1mA Isolation Resistance R iso 5×1010 1×1011 — Ω DC500V 40 ~ 60% R.H. Floating Capacitance C f — 0.6 1 pF V=0, f=1MHz Cut-Off Frequency f c 15 80 — kHz VCE=5V, IC=2mA RL=100Ω, -3dB Response Time (Rise) t r — 4 18 µs TRANSFER CHARACTERISTICS Response Time (Fall) t f — 3 18 µs VCE=2V, IC=2mA RL=100Ω, * CTR I I 100%C F Part No. : LTV-733 ( M, S, -TA1 ) Page : 6o f9 BNS-OD-C131/A4
